i see there are easy methods of exporting operators that deal with
values and mathematical operations, but is there any chance of exporting
pointer-to operators?
in this particular case i am exporting a custom interface pointer class
to python.
in c++ i can use such a smart pointer like this:
Ptr<View> view(L"µ.Sandoz.View");
if (view)
{
view->Attach(hWnd, true);
...
where Ptr<T> exposes its member T _object using
InterfaceType* operator->()
{
return _object;
}
i'm exposing Ptr<View> as "View" and the View interface as
"ViewInterface" to python.
what i'd like to write in python would be something along the lines of
view = View("µ.Sandoz.View")
view.Attach(self.window, true)
can i realize this without much trouble?
